From 85217382d640022f7d2374b0da78d5f2b8b4521b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Lin Jian Date: Fri, 25 Aug 2023 12:19:44 +0800 Subject: pass: stop installing password-store.el password-store.el is on MELPA so it is available in Nixpkgs as emacs.pkgs.password-store. Using emacs.pkgs.password-store is preferred because of better package quality: - Emacs lisp package dependencies are automatically installed - byte-compilation is done - native-compilation is done --- nixos/doc/manual/release-notes/rl-2311.section.md | 2 ++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+) (limited to 'nixos') diff --git a/nixos/doc/manual/release-notes/rl-2311.section.md b/nixos/doc/manual/release-notes/rl-2311.section.md index 623576ce4ff28..0b293835f150b 100644 --- a/nixos/doc/manual/release-notes/rl-2311.section.md +++ b/nixos/doc/manual/release-notes/rl-2311.section.md @@ -66,6 +66,8 @@ - `python3.pkgs.fetchPypi` (and `python3Packages.fetchPypi`) has been deprecated in favor of top-level `fetchPypi`. +- `pass` now does not contain `password-store.el`.
